Insight Meditation is a direct and simple form of practice that allows one to move towards a more peaceful and awakened state of mind. This practice helps to free the mind and emotions from reactivity, fear and stress, leading to steadiness, wisdom and compassion in everyday life and relationships.
The day focuses on a series of short meditations with detailed instructions followed by a time for questions and reflections. We begin with a correct posture for meditation – chairs and cushions are available or bring your own. We then move to establishing the breath as the primary object of meditation. Hearing and walking meditation are also presented in detail. Brief presentations of the key principles of Insight Meditation are included at different points throughout the day.
